BillySMP exists because paying a monthly fee for a Bedrock realm got old fast. The first version ran straight off a personal gaming PC — which worked, until people got tired of the server vanishing every time that PC was needed for literally anything else.
Around the same time, an unrelated side project — buying a stack of old HP EliteDesks to flip for cash — flopped completely; the machines were just too old to be worth anything. Rather than let them go to waste, the best of the bunch (a 4th-gen Intel i5, with whatever spare RAM could be scavenged: 2x4GB and 2x2GB) got pulled aside and became BillySMP v2, the first dedicated host.
Not long after, an unrelated equipment auction — some business liquidating its stuff — turned up a Lenovo ThinkStation E35, bought on pure impulse. It didn't even boot. That was fine at the time; it was roughly the same age and spec as the EliteDesk already running the show, so it just sat there.
The upgrade motivation eventually showed up the hard way: BillySMP got hacked, kicking off a full security-hardening pass, right around when the EliteDesk was clearly starting to show its age. Cracking open the dead ThinkStation turned up good news — standard ATX power supply, standard mATX motherboard, nothing proprietary hiding under the OEM shell. A new motherboard, a Ryzen 5 7600, some spare RAM, and a spare PSU later, it powered on. The front-panel button and LEDs got manually re-pinned to match; the front USB and the CF/SD/MicroSD card reader (plus a couple of still-unidentified mystery ports) got left disconnected rather than risk depinning those solo.
Months later, the missing front USB got annoying enough to actually look into — turns out that whole panel just runs off a standard USB header. The connector on it was just the wrong physical size for the new motherboard's pins. The fix a reasonable person would've made felt like more effort than it was worth, so the plug ends got snipped off outright instead. It's worked fine ever since — front USB and the card reader included, which is exactly what's used today to update the CF/SD disaster-recovery backups.
